#StablecoinDebateHeatsUp 💵🔥


The stablecoin market is entering a critical phase as regulators, financial institutions, and crypto-native players intensify their debate over the future of fiat-backed digital assets. Once considered a niche innovation, stablecoins have now become a core layer of global payments, liquidity, and on-chain financial activity.
🔍 Key Highlights:
🔹 Regulatory Momentum Builds
Governments are accelerating efforts to introduce clear frameworks, focusing on reserve transparency, compliance standards, and risk management. Policies targeting yield-generating stablecoins are beginning to reshape market expectations.
🔹 Rising Tensions with Banks
Traditional financial institutions are increasingly concerned about capital flowing into stablecoins, which could impact deposit bases and credit systems. This is turning the conversation into competition vs. collaboration between banks and crypto firms.
🔹 Transparency Becomes Essential
Stablecoin issuers are under growing pressure to prove reserve backing, improve auditability, and maintain trust. Transparency is no longer optional—it’s becoming the foundation for long-term sustainability.
🔹 Market Role Remains Strong
Despite regulatory uncertainty, stablecoins continue to dominate trading, cross-border payments, and DeFi activity, reinforcing their position as a bridge between traditional finance and blockchain ecosystems.
📊 Final Thought:
The stablecoin debate is no longer theoretical—it’s actively shaping the future of digital finance. The balance between regulation, innovation, and institutional adoption will define the next phase of the global financial system.
